Red Storm tiptoes its way to a ninth place finish at nationals
The St. John’s University dance team went to Florida lastweekend with its dancing shoes and high spirits and finished ninthplace in the 2004 College Cheerleading and Dance Team NationalChampionship.
The Red Storm’s ninth place finish in the Division I section ofthe UDA Championships is the highest ever for the team and betterthan last year’s 13th place finish.
“We’re thrilled at our finish,” dance team head coach ChristineMcCarton said. “The kids have worked really hard for this, andthey’re excited.”
Cal State Fullerton finished first followed by Sam Houston Stateand Hofstra. Rounding out the top-10 were Southwest Missouri State,Delaware, Southeastern Louisiana, George Mason, Northern Arizona,St. John’s and Oakland University.
The St. John’s Dance Team has existed for more than 40 years,and is filled with tradition and pride.
Every year, students with various dance backgrounds performduring time-outs and halftime of all home basketball games atAlumni Hall and Madison Square Garden as well as at home soccergames.
While most of its season is spent supporting the Red Storm, thedance team competes annually and entered this year’s championshipswith a 13th ranking among Division I squads.
